35 BRERETON CLOSE is a very small semi-detached house of 64m², built sometime between 1950 and 1966. It was last sold for £249,950 in August 2024, which was around 25% below the average August 2024 detached price in the East Riding of Yorksh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was December 2014,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the East Riding of Yorksh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 35 BRERETON CLOSE sales from February 2015 and August 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the February 2015 sale was for 23%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 23% below the HPI over time, until the August 2024 sale, where it falls to 25%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 25% below the HPI.

35 BRERETON CLOSE sits on a plot of roughly 0.071 of an acre, or 287m². The below map shows the location of 35 BRERETON CLOSE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 35 BRERETON CLOSE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
